The Impact of Temperature Level on Paint Application
When you're preparing a business external painting job, the temperature can considerably affect just how well the paint adheres and dries.
Preferably, you wish to paint when temperatures range between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. If it's also cold, the paint might not cure properly, leading to problems like peeling off or cracking.
On the flip side, if it's too hot, the paint can dry out as well swiftly, preventing correct adhesion and resulting in an unequal coating.
You must likewise consider the time of day; early morning or late afternoon supplies cooler temperatures, which can be more favorable.
Always inspect the supplier's suggestions for the specific paint you're utilizing, as they often provide guidance on the suitable temperature array for ideal results.

Best Seasons for Commercial Outside Paint Projects
What's the most effective time of year for your industrial external painting projects?
Spring and early fall are normally your best bets. During these periods, temperatures are light, and humidity levels are typically reduced, developing excellent problems for paint application and drying.
Avoid summertime's intense heat, which can create paint to completely dry also swiftly, leading to inadequate adhesion and finish. In a similar way, wintertime's chilly temperatures can prevent proper drying and curing, risking the longevity of your paint work.
Go for days with temperature levels between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for ideal outcomes. Keep in mind to examine the neighborhood weather prediction for rainfall, as damp problems can wreck your job.
Planning around these factors guarantees your painting project runs smoothly and lasts much longer.
